**Ticket: Missed pick-up — returned demo units**

Hey — Bramleaf Audio's courier never showed yesterday for the six demo speaker units in bay 4. They've rebooked for tomorrow morning, first slot. Units are boxed and labelled already, so just wheel them to the dock when the van arrives. One thing though — the courier needs the hand-over instruction below, word for word.

dispatch memo: the aldath julath courier leaves the zoriel queneth oliok ledger at gate 3795 under passcode 816528

**Q: Why does Pedalshift sometimes suggest moving bikes to a full dock?**

Short answer: stale telemetry. Pedalshift's rebalancing planner pulls dock occupancy from the Spoketown feed every five minutes, so if a dock fills up mid-cycle, the plan can lag reality. The truck crews know to skip obviously full docks, but it does skew our efficiency stats. Marnie is working on a streaming fix for next quarter. If you want the gritty details, the planner internals are documented on the wiki.

runbook for tajep-yahig: https://artifactory.lumictech.corp/repo

## Configuration

Plugins for the `tailgrove` CLI read their settings from the `.tailgrove.env` file in the workspace root. Before registering a plugin, confirm that `TAILGROVE_PLUGIN_DIR` points to your build output and that `TAILGROVE_BUFFER_LINES` is set to a sane value (we recommend 500 for remote streams). The daemon also requires an authentication token to attach to the central log relay. Add the following line to your env file:

secret setting of bajog-fawip: ARCHIVE_KEY3=b03